Da Burger Wing Hub is a casual Wahiawā stop built around burgers, wings, and drinks, but it stands out for being more than a grab-and-go comfort-food counter. On Central Oʻahu, it reads as a neighborhood-friendly dinner spot with enough bar energy and menu range to work for a relaxed meal, a group outing, or an easy lunch when the craving is for something hearty and familiar.

What it does best

The menu leans squarely into American comfort food: burgers first, wings second, with sandwiches, fries, and a few richer extras rounding things out. The strongest reason to go is the burger lineup, which goes well beyond a basic cheeseburger. Specialty builds like the short rib burger, fajita burger, hangover burger, black and blue burger, and juicy lucy give the kitchen some personality, while the wings keep the concept grounded in classic casual fare.

That balance matters. Da Burger Wing Hub is not trying to be a minimalist smashburger shop or a polished gastropub. It is a fuller, more indulgent comfort-food place, with rotating specials that add some novelty for repeat visits. For travelers wanting a meal that feels satisfying rather than fussy, that is a real advantage.

The feel of the place

The experience skews social and easygoing. The restaurant’s setup includes dine-in service, reservations, private parties, catering, and delivery, which points to a place designed for flexible use rather than a quick in-and-out format only. The addition of cocktails gives it another dimension, and the bar side makes the concept feel more active than the name might suggest.

That broader identity gives it appeal beyond burger night. Owner Arjay Mijares and managing partner RJ Valmonte built the business with both food and bar service in mind, and that shows in the concept. It has the feel of a local hangout that can handle a casual family meal, a meetup with friends, or a low-key evening with drinks.

Who it’s best for

This is an especially good fit for travelers who want a straightforward, affordable comfort-food meal in Central Oʻahu without sacrificing a little energy or variety. It also works well for groups, since the menu has enough crowd-pleasers to keep most people happy. The family-friendly angle is real, but it does not feel overly stiff or formal.

The tradeoff is equally clear: diners looking for lighter food, broad vegetarian or vegan options, or a more refined dining room will likely want something else. The menu is meat-forward, and the whole concept is built around burgers, wings, and bar fare. It is a strong match for indulgence, not for restraint.

Practical notes for travelers

Da Burger Wing Hub sits on North Kamehameha Highway in Wahiawā, making it a convenient Central Oʻahu stop rather than a destination that demands a special detour. Its late lunch and dinner hours fit well with casual travel schedules, and the availability of delivery can be handy for nearby stays.

If you go, the smartest order is usually one of the specialty burgers or a rotating special rather than stopping at the most basic options. The cocktail program is also worth noting if you want the meal to feel a little more like a night out than a standard burger run.
